Transaction f8c92a1781a3866c6441a77db04c7556108d25789722a566bbb987917f9f2d29
2 Input
2 Outputs
- f8c92a1781a3866c6441a77db04c7556108d25789722a566bbb987917f9f2d29:0
- f8c92a1781a3866c6441a77db04c7556108d25789722a566bbb987917f9f2d29:1
value 11372941
address 16Px8VqgtTB1vZs33FiJ5Ac9xtDBvNHDw5
value 1031941
address 1EBmu6p3Agz3qZ8dKHnRpnmDki67vBYppL